1

5 Essential Elements For tow bar cape town

News Discuss 
The cost of obtaining a tow bar equipped onto your automobile varies depending on what auto It really is on. Our tow bar industry experts can show you the amount of it will eventually set you back when you let them know which vehicle you individual. The tow bar industry https://yeepdirectory.com/listings12701198/the-5-second-trick-for-towbars-in-capetown

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story